The Browning is a 1922
The holsters have a heavy infestation of mold. Likely these came out of a closet or basement with high humidity. Lucky the pistols are not covered in rust. Your Luger holster is missing it's original roller buckle assembly. It has some sort of home made thing in place of it. The gold colored parts on your 1936 are strawing, a mild protection for rust like bluing. 1936 was the last year Mauser used it. The wood bottom magazine is decades removed from the pistol, WW1
